His tolerance did not make Su Chang feel grateful. Instead, Su Chang felt that Jiang Wenfeng was playing with him and humiliating him. While Su Chang was inwardly furious, he was also secretly somewhat shocked. Last time… during the sparring session just over ten days ago, he had just beaten Jiang Wenfeng up badly. Now only around ten days had passed. How had this boy suddenly become so much stronger? With doubt in his heart, Su Chang returned to his seat.
In this exchange, on the surface, it seemed the two were evenly matched, but anyone with sharp eyes knew that Jiang Wenfeng's strength had already surpassed his. If the two were similar in age and family background, it would not be that strange. The key was that he was older than Jiang Wenfeng, and his family background was better too. More importantly, he had been toyed with in front of his future wife, making Su Chang feel he had lost a great deal of face.
With a bright pearl before them, the following paired sparring became somewhat dull and tasteless. After the day's cultivation ended, the many disciples all left the training ground. Only Jiang Wenfeng remained. He wanted to continue cultivating. A steady personality was his strong point. The power that had suddenly surged within his body a few days ago had made his strength rise sharply. If it were another child of the same age, they might already have become smug. Jiang Wenfeng did not.
He had always felt that the sudden power in his body had been obtained through putting in more hardship than ordinary people, so he worked even harder than before. In the rear courtyard of the martial arts school, after cultivation ended, Huang Lingxiu impatiently ran back to the rear courtyard and told Huang Qingzhou about today's comparison.
"Father, Junior Brother Stone is just a fool. He clearly could have knocked Su Chang down and properly taken revenge for being bullied before, yet he chose to tolerate it."
"If it were me, I would definitely beat him until even his parents couldn't recognize him!" Huang Lingxiu said angrily. She truly could not understand why Jiang Wenfeng clearly had a chance for revenge but did not seize it. Looking at his daughter's puffed-up appearance, Huang Qingzhou shook his head slightly.
"Come. Let's go look at that boy." The father and daughter came to the training ground in the front courtyard. Seeing that Jiang Wenfeng was indeed still cultivating, Huang Qingzhou said in a low voice, "Do you see? Stone is clearly already very strong now, yet he is still working hard."
"In terms of talent, you are not worse than Stone. In terms of resources, you are even far above him."
"If you could work hard like him, there would even be hope for you to break through to the Acquired Realm by the time you come of age." Hearing this, Huang Lingxiu slightly curled her lips. She also knew that hard work would certainly bring gains, but as soon as she thought of the boredom and pain of cultivation, she instantly lost energy.
"Father, let's go over." Not wanting to discuss this topic with her father, Huang Lingxiu quickly pulled him to the training ground. Jiang Wenfeng saw the two arrive. He slowly withdrew from his stance training and came forward, cupping his hands.

"You clearly had a chance to defeat him. Why did you tolerate him again and again?"
"In a martial artist's duel, what matters is defeating the enemy in one move. Being soft-hearted will only put you in danger." Jiang Wenfeng was slightly stunned. Seeing that there was no blame on Huang Qingzhou's face, he immediately cupped his hands and said, "Elder Uncle, this nephew could indeed easily defeat Senior Brother Su Chang, but I cannot do that."
"Why?" Huang Lingxiu asked in confusion. Jiang Wenfeng smiled bitterly.
"Senior Sister should know that my family is only an ordinary farming household in Golden Willow Village, while Su Chang's eldest uncle is the Deputy County Magistrate of our Willow County."
"That is the heaven of Willow County. If I defeated him in public to vent my anger and damaged his face, it would inevitably cause his resentment."
"If he wanted to take revenge on me, that would not matter much. But if it implicated my family…"
"Counting the time, Mother should be about to give birth. Father supports a large family by himself, and it is not easy. I cannot add more trouble for them." Hearing these words, Huang Lingxiu fell silent. In truth, she was three years older than Jiang Wenfeng, but she had never considered so much. In her eyes, if she caused trouble, her father would stand behind her. If that still did not work, then there was also her eldest uncle in the army.
Within the small territory of Willow County, as long as it was not something that seriously violated Great Yu's laws, it was not a major matter. She had never thought that there were so many hidden dangers. Huang Qingzhou's eyes were full of praise. In his heart, he faintly began to envy Jiang Huanyu. At such a young age, this child had a steady personality, handled matters smoothly, and thought things through carefully. In the future, he would surely achieve something extraordinary.
With a son like this, how could a family not prosper? Unfortunately, he only had two daughters. His eldest daughter had left her hometown after breaking through to the Acquired Realm in her early years. These years, she only occasionally sent a letter back to report that she was safe, and he did not know exactly where she had gone.
"Your concerns are not wrong, but there is one point you overlooked." Huang Qingzhou's expression suddenly became serious. Jiang Wenfeng did not understand and quickly cupped his hands.
"Please teach me, Elder Uncle."
"You overlooked human nature," Huang Qingzhou said with his hands behind his back and a sigh.
"Human nature is the most complicated thing."
"You think that by not defeating Su Chang in public, you left him some face."
"But Su Chang may not think that way. With his personality, he will only feel that you were toying with him and humiliating him."
"That is far harder to accept than being defeated by you."
"This is how people interact. If you are only a little stronger than him, he will envy you and scheme against you in every possible way."
"But if you are much stronger than him, so strong that he cannot hope to reach you, then he will only admire you and fear you."
"Hiding your edge is good, but hiding your edge too much will only make others think your sword is not sharp and cannot kill."
"The degree between the two is something only you yourself can consider and control." Huang Qingzhou's teaching clearly conflicted somewhat with his father Jiang Huanyu's words, and Jiang Wenfeng felt a little confused for a time. His father told him to be humble and low-key, while Huang Qingzhou told him to reveal his sword at the right time.
"All right. Do not disturb Stone's cultivation. Let's go." After Huang Qingzhou said this, he took his daughter and left. Jiang Wenfeng stood alone on the training ground and thought for a long time. Suddenly, he smiled. Whether it was hiding his edge and staying low-key, or revealing his sword at the right time, didn't he still have to control it himself? And what ultimately decided all of this was still his own strength. Strength was his greatest confidence. With strength, he could choose as he pleased.
Without strength, he had no right to choose. After understanding this, he began to continue cultivating. The next day, it was time to return home again. Early in the morning, Jiang Huanyu drove the ox cart to the entrance of the martial arts school. Jiang Wenfeng bid farewell to the teachers of the martial arts school, stepped onto the ox cart, and followed Jiang Huanyu toward Golden Willow Village.
"Father, has Mother given birth?" At the mention of this matter, Jiang Huanyu, who was driving the cart in front, turned back and could not help smiling.
"Guess whether it is a younger brother or a younger sister." Jiang Wenfeng tilted his head and thought for a while.
"If it is a younger brother, I can teach him martial arts in the future. If it is a younger sister, she will definitely be as beautiful as Mother."
"Heh!" Jiang Huanyu directly turned around and laughed while scolding, "Stinky brat, who did you learn that from? You've become quite good at speaking." Jiang Wenfeng smiled and scratched his head.
"Senior Sister Lingxiu said that martial artists are not brutes. They cannot be illiterate and refuse to read. During this year at the martial arts school, whenever I had free time, I would ask Senior Sister Lingxiu for guidance and borrowed some books from Elder Uncle to read." Hearing this, Jiang Huanyu rubbed his head with relief. At this moment, he suddenly felt that this son had grown up quite a lot.
"Your mother gave birth to a younger brother and a younger sister for you."
"Ah!?" Jiang Wenfeng opened his mouth wide in shock. Clearly, with his understanding, he still did not quite understand how a person could give birth to two children at once.
"Your younger sister is called Jiang Wenping, and your younger brother is called Jiang wenchen." After receiving confirmation again, Jiang Wenfeng became extremely excited. At this moment, his heart had already flown back to Golden Willow Village, impatient to see his younger brother and younger sister.
